Reducing an affliction's strength by any given amount using chemicals may not translate into that amount being restored to the character's vitality.Īn affliction's strength and its effect on vitality are two interdependent values in Barotrauma, and the latter may be scaled to vitality: as such, for example, reducing Internal Damage strength by 24 - using Opium, successfully - will effectively restore 20 vitality to a Captain (whose maximum Vitality is 80), 22.5 Vitality to an Engineer (whose maximum Vitality is 90) and 25 Vitality to a Security Officer (whose maximum Vitality is 100). The values below represent affliction strength reduction, not to be mistaken with a vitality restoration. The Syringe Gun can also be used if a chemical needs to be injected from a distance. The player's character will swing the syringe and inject its effects to anything it hits, both Creatures and players. By holding the "Aim" keybind (Right Mouse Button by default) and pressing the "Shoot" keybind (Left Mouse Button by default). Most chemicals come in a syringe, which allows the chemicals to be used without the Health GUI.
